[ubuntu/noble-proposed] procps 2:4.0.4-2ubuntu1 (Accepted)
Lukas Märdian
slyon at ubuntu.com
Tue Nov 21 13:18:12 UTC 2023
procps (2:4.0.4-2ubuntu1) noble; urgency=medium
* Merge with Debian unstable. Remaining changes:
- d/t/stack-limit: add basic autopkgtest to validate limits
- Add basic autopkgtest to validate sysctl-defaults (LP#1962038)
- ignore_eaccess.patch: If we get eaccess when opening a sysctl file for
writing, don't error out. Otherwise package upgrades can fail,
especially in containers.
- Adjust logic due to rc no longer being propagated (LP#1903351)
- ignore_erofs.patch: Same as ignore_eaccess but for the case where
part of /proc is read/only.
- Adjust logic due to rc no longer being propagated (LP#1903351)
- debian/sysctl.d (Ubuntu-specific):
+ 10-console-messages.conf: stop low-level kernel messages on console.
+ 10-kernel-hardening.conf: add the kptr_restrict setting
+ 10-ipv6-privacy.conf: add a file to sysctl.d to apply the defaults
for IPv6 privacy extensions for interfaces. (LP#176125, LP#841353)
+ 10-magic-sysrq.conf: Disable most magic sysrq by default, allowing
critical sync, remount, reboot functions. (LP#194676, LP#1025467)
+ 10-network-security.conf: enable rp_filter.
+ 10-ptrace.conf: describe new PTRACE setting.
+ 10-zeropage.conf: safe mmap_min_addr value for graceful fall-back.
for armhf, and arm64.
+ 10-qemu.conf.s390x for qemu.
* d/p/0010-testsuite-ps-etime-ELAPSED-doesn-t-match-full-format.patch:
Fix test failure (FTBFS) in testsuite/ps.test/ps_output.exp due to invalid
regex match inside LXD containers.
procps (2:4.0.4-2) unstable; urgency=medium
* Loosen regex and check file perms in pmap test Closes: #1052034
* pkgtest: Update vmstat check
* Skip pmap -X/XX PID PID check as flakey on buildds
procps (2:4.0.4-1) unstable; urgency=medium
* New upstream release
- ps: Fix buffer overflow in -C option CVE-2023-4016 Closes: #1042887
- library: Refactor the escape code Closes: #1035649
- pgrep: Use only --signal option for signal Closes: #1031765
- pgrep: suppress >15 warning if using regex Closes: #1037450
- ps: fixed missing or corrupted fields with -m option Closes: #1036631
- free: New -L option for one line output
- ps: New --signames options to show signal names
* watch: Color support turned on by default use -C to turn off
* Remove redundant lines from sysctl.conf Closes: #968711
Date: Tue, 21 Nov 2023 11:54:36 +0100
Changed-By: Lukas Märdian <slyon at ubuntu.com>
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
https://launchpad.net/ubuntu/+source/procps/2:4.0.4-2ubuntu1
-------------- next part --------------
Format: 1.8
Date: Tue, 21 Nov 2023 11:54:36 +0100
Source: procps
Built-For-Profiles: noudeb
Architecture: source
Version: 2:4.0.4-2ubuntu1
Distribution: noble
Urgency: medium
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
Changed-By: Lukas Märdian <slyon at ubuntu.com>
Closes: 968711 1031765 1035649 1036631 1037450 1042887 1052034
Changes:
procps (2:4.0.4-2ubuntu1) noble; urgency=medium
.
* Merge with Debian unstable. Remaining changes:
- d/t/stack-limit: add basic autopkgtest to validate limits
- Add basic autopkgtest to validate sysctl-defaults (LP#1962038)
- ignore_eaccess.patch: If we get eaccess when opening a sysctl file for
writing, don't error out. Otherwise package upgrades can fail,
especially in containers.
- Adjust logic due to rc no longer being propagated (LP#1903351)
- ignore_erofs.patch: Same as ignore_eaccess but for the case where
part of /proc is read/only.
- Adjust logic due to rc no longer being propagated (LP#1903351)
- debian/sysctl.d (Ubuntu-specific):
+ 10-console-messages.conf: stop low-level kernel messages on console.
+ 10-kernel-hardening.conf: add the kptr_restrict setting
+ 10-ipv6-privacy.conf: add a file to sysctl.d to apply the defaults
for IPv6 privacy extensions for interfaces. (LP#176125, LP#841353)
+ 10-magic-sysrq.conf: Disable most magic sysrq by default, allowing
critical sync, remount, reboot functions. (LP#194676, LP#1025467)
+ 10-network-security.conf: enable rp_filter.
+ 10-ptrace.conf: describe new PTRACE setting.
+ 10-zeropage.conf: safe mmap_min_addr value for graceful fall-back.
for armhf, and arm64.
+ 10-qemu.conf.s390x for qemu.
* d/p/0010-testsuite-ps-etime-ELAPSED-doesn-t-match-full-format.patch:
Fix test failure (FTBFS) in testsuite/ps.test/ps_output.exp due to invalid
regex match inside LXD containers.
.
procps (2:4.0.4-2) unstable; urgency=medium
.
* Loosen regex and check file perms in pmap test Closes: #1052034
* pkgtest: Update vmstat check
* Skip pmap -X/XX PID PID check as flakey on buildds
.
procps (2:4.0.4-1) unstable; urgency=medium
.
* New upstream release
- ps: Fix buffer overflow in -C option CVE-2023-4016 Closes: #1042887
- library: Refactor the escape code Closes: #1035649
- pgrep: Use only --signal option for signal Closes: #1031765
- pgrep: suppress >15 warning if using regex Closes: #1037450
- ps: fixed missing or corrupted fields with -m option Closes: #1036631
- free: New -L option for one line output
- ps: New --signames options to show signal names
* watch: Color support turned on by default use -C to turn off
* Remove redundant lines from sysctl.conf Closes: #968711
Checksums-Sha1:
d9afae8cbf4e76f8b13c84cacb6dd94f566a770c 2243 procps_4.0.4-2ubuntu1.dsc
2b859acd7060e9898ac457dbd26dbebf563cc44b 1401540 procps_4.0.4.orig.tar.xz
6aa182d9d7ad106395b2a2dd78faa6c635ff9375 36848 procps_4.0.4-2ubuntu1.debian.tar.xz
2c61c84d4b0e1ec044a39d80e6091793a97d61e1 8160 procps_4.0.4-2ubuntu1_source.buildinfo
Checksums-Sha256:
aa7834509effa1e007107fb89e8fd3cbb8f2b8a9fd734de5c803e33adf68c39d 2243 procps_4.0.4-2ubuntu1.dsc
22870d6feb2478adb617ce4f09a787addaf2d260c5a8aa7b17d889a962c5e42e 1401540 procps_4.0.4.orig.tar.xz
1f116aad757e9acfebfcd28cc643b20dd3a4fbc90f8d92be8faa4933675378ec 36848 procps_4.0.4-2ubuntu1.debian.tar.xz
4419f86c4dca60c629c1921513126fb115cb12e349e077389c985a83eed43b46 8160 procps_4.0.4-2ubuntu1_source.buildinfo
Files:
83c60be0bdb92c33ea634b7d7a8defa1 2243 admin optional procps_4.0.4-2ubuntu1.dsc
2f747fc7df8ccf402d03e375c565cf96 1401540 admin optional procps_4.0.4.orig.tar.xz
a229a9aaa40edb80537e3cba06d01db2 36848 admin optional procps_4.0.4-2ubuntu1.debian.tar.xz
4a52364732616fcdfa1e4c3486def31f 8160 admin optional procps_4.0.4-2ubuntu1_source.buildinfo
Original-Maintainer: Craig Small <csmall at debian.org>
Vcs-Git: https://git.launchpad.net/~slyon/ubuntu/+source/procps
Vcs-Git-Ref: refs/heads/MERGE-noble
Vcs-Git-Commit: 78383b090b5333bc3aa230c599e92b00e775d359
More information about the noble-changes
mailing list